/** * Check to see if all the chars in the value of a property are valid. * * @param value value to check * * @return false if a character is not valid for a value */ static MIDPError checkMfValueChars(const pcsl_string * mfvalue) { jchar current; int i = 0; MIDPError err = ALL_OK; GET_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H(mfvalue) if (PCSL_STRING_PARAMETER_ERROR(mfvalue)) { err = OUT_OF_MEMORY; } else { while (i < mfvalue_len) { current = mfvalue_data[i]; /* if current is a CTL character, return an error */ if ((current <= 0x1F || current == 0x7F) && (current != HT)) { printPcslStringWithMessage("checkMfValueChars: BAD_MF_VALUE ", mfvalue); err = BAD_MF_VALUE; break; } i++; } /* end of while */ } RELEASE_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H return err; } /* end of checkMfValueChars */

/** * Check to see if all the chars in the key of a property are valid. * * @param jadkey key to check * @return BAD_JAD_KEY if a character is not valid for a key */ static MIDPError checkJadKeyChars(const pcsl_string * jadkey) { jchar current; int i = 0; MIDPError err = ALL_OK; GET_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H(jadkey) if (PCSL_STRING_PARAMETER_ERROR(jadkey)) { err = OUT_OF_MEMORY; } else { while (i < jadkey_len) { current = jadkey_data[i]; if (current <= 0x1F || current == 0x7F || current == '(' || current == ')' || current == '<' || current == '>' || current == '@' || current == ',' || current == ';' || current == '\'' || current == '"' || current == '/' || current == '[' || current == ']' || current == '?' || current == '=' || current == '{' || current == '}' || current == SP || current == HT) { printPcslStringWithMessage("checkJadKeyChars: BAD_JAD_KEY ", jadkey); err = BAD_JAD_KEY; break; } i++; } /* end of while */ } RELEASE_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H return err; }
/** * Check to see if all the chars in the key of a property are valid. * * @param key key to check * * @return an error if a character is not valid for a key */ static MIDPError checkMfKeyChars(const pcsl_string * mfkey) { /* IMPL NOTE: why chars in manifest key are different from jad key? */ jchar current; int i = 0; MIDPError err = ALL_OK; GET_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H(mfkey) if (PCSL_STRING_PARAMETER_ERROR(mfkey)) { err = OUT_OF_MEMORY; } else { while (i < mfkey_len) { current = mfkey_data[i]; i++; if (current >= 'A' && current <= 'Z') { continue; } if (current >= 'a' && current <= 'z') { continue; } if (current >= '0' && current <= '9') { continue; } if ((i - 1) > 0 && (current == '-' || current == '_')) { continue; } printPcslStringWithMessage("checkMfKeyChars: BAD_MF_KEY ", mfkey); err = BAD_MF_KEY; break; } /* end of while */ } RELEASE_PCSL_STRING_DATA_AND_LENGTH return err; } /* end of checkMfKeyChars */
